This MCCB offers a robust solution with its notable features and compliance with industry standards.</p><p>Rated for a current of 250 A, this MCCB ensures efficient power management in various electrical systems. It operates at a rated voltage of 690 VAC, making it suitable for high-voltage applications. With an impressive rated insulation voltage of 1000 V and an impulse withstand voltage of 8 kV, this device is designed to handle significant electrical stress, ensuring safety and durability.</p><p>The Ekip Dip LSI trip unit enhances operational efficiency by providing precise protection against overloads and short circuits. The release type EL further adds to its reliability in maintaining system integrity under challenging conditions.</p><p>This MCCB boasts a breaking capacity of 20 kA, which means it can safely interrupt fault currents up to that level without damage. Its four-pole configuration provides comprehensive protection across all phases, essential for balanced load distribution in three-phase systems.</p><p>Installation is straightforward thanks to its front connection type and bolt terminal design. The main circuit connecting capacity ranges from 85-200 sq-mm, offering flexibility in accommodating various conductor sizes.</p><p>Measuring at a width of 140 mm and weighing approximately 3.5 kg, this compact yet sturdy device fits well into most panel setups without compromising on performance or space efficiency.</p><p>In terms of safety ratings, the IP20 degree of protection indicates that the MCCB is protected against solid objects greater than 12 mm but does not offer water resistance; hence it&#39;s best suited for indoor use where exposure to moisture is minimal.</p><p>Compliance with IEC60947-2 standards assures you that this product meets international benchmarks for low-voltage switchgear and control gear components. Furthermore, it’s compatible with XT4L setups enhancing its versatility within existing frameworks.</p><p>With power loss measured at just 16.4 W during operation, energy efficiency remains high while minimizing heat generation - an important factor when considering long-term operational costs and thermal management within electrical enclosures.</p><p>Overall, if you&#39;re looking for a dependable MCCB that combines excellent performance characteristics with adherence to global standards - ensuring both safety and functionality - this model presents itself as a worthy consideration.</p>
